FRIDAY AT JAZZBONES IN TACOMA >>>

Puyallup legends SweetKiss Momma (yeah, I called 'em legends) will be at Jazzbones in Tacoma Friday with Guns of Nevada and Midnight Salvage Co. The show - besides being sure to rock - is a celebration of sorts for local podcaster Darrell Fortune and his South Sound centered show, the Northwest Convergence Zone. Fortune and the Zone recently took home fifth place in King 5's Best of Western Washington poll - which is a pretty impressive feat for a weekly podcast produced in Fortune's garage (in fairness, it's a fucking awesome garage).

SweetKiss Momma lead singer Jeff Hamel tells me the last time the band was at Jazzbones they sold the place out - by over 100 people. While I'm not sure what the fire marshall would have to say about that, what fans of Southern-tinged rock would holler is, "hell-fucking-yeah."

Catch SweetKiss Momma along with Guns of Nevada and Midnight Salvage Co. Friday at Jazzbones.
